The Cabinet Sub-Committee has favored a cautious approach towards the Central Government's proposed rural employment legislation VB-G RAM G, expressing concerns over its potential adverse effects on state interests and vulnerable sections.
- Cabinet Sub-Committee expressed concerns over VB-G RAM G legislation affecting state interests and weakening protections for weaker sections.
- Committee resolved to dissent over significant omissions and commissions in the proposed framework of the Act.
- Committee recommended amendments to safeguard interests of workers, self-help groups, rural households, and vulnerable sections.
